The Merit-based Incentive Payment System (MIPS) scores providers 0–100 across four performance categories: Quality, Cost, Promoting Interoperability, and Improvement Activities, weighted under 42 CFR §414.1380. Reporting is voluntary for many small practices, so absence of a MIPS score is not a quality signal.

JAMIE DIAMOND appears in the CMS NPPES registry as a Student in an Organized Health Care Education/Training Program provider at 1364 CLIFTON RD NE, ATLANTA, GA, 30322, with a listed phone of (404) 712-2000. NPI 1770946634 was issued on 03/29/2016. Because NPPES data is self-reported by the provider and refreshed monthly, the address, phone, and specialty reflect what DIAMOND most recently submitted to CMS rather than a vetted directory listing, which is why patients should always confirm the practice is still at this location before scheduling.
Medicare Part D records for calendar year 2023 show 250 prescription claims written by this provider, covering 77 Medicare beneficiaries and totaling roughly $66K in drug spend, split 22% brand-name and 78% generic by claim count. These figures capture only Medicare Part D — commercial insurance, Medicaid, and cash-pay prescriptions are not included, and any drug-beneficiary cell under 11 is suppressed by CMS for patient privacy. On the CMS Merit-based Incentive Payment System, this provider earned a Final Score of 92.2614/100 for the 2023 performance year (Quality 73.8353), compared with the national average of 83.1.
Student in an Organized Health Care Education/Training Program is a high-volume specialty nationwide, with 331,761 enrolled providers across 55 states and an average of 459 Part D claims per prescriber, so the context for interpreting these metrics differs meaningfully from a primary-care baseline. - Limitations
- Provider data is self-reported to CMS. Prescribing data reflects Medicare Part D only and does not include commercial insurance, Medicaid, or cash prescriptions. Claims below 11 beneficiaries are suppressed by CMS for privacy.
